I went from a Treo 650 ((PalmOS) whose screen cracked when dropped (go figure)) to a 700w (which I was jazzed about for the 1st week) to a 6700 (which I've had for about 6mnths and am still digging it quite a bit).
The 700w was so crammed with Palm-proprietary crap that upon bootup, I had ~10Meg free of memory to run programs. I was constantly 'killing' apps that retreated to the background. The dialpad was fugly and could not be skinned (that I knew of)...Due to it's limitations, I decided to sell on eBay, and trade up to the 6700. That move was the best move in terms of value and enjoyment out of a phone I have ever made. |
